Little Italy stores in Staunton, Illinois on Map
Little Italy store locations in Staunton (Illinois)
More Little Italy stores in Illinois - IL
Little Italy stores located in Staunton: 1
Little Italy store locator Staunton displays complete list and huge database of Little Italy stores, factory stores, shops and boutiques in Staunton (Illinois). Little Italy information: map of Staunton, shopping hours, contact information.
More Little Italy stores in Illinois - IL
Search all Little Italy stores located in Staunton, Illinois